- Description
- GlenDronach's 1995 distillate matured 19 years in Pedro Ximénez sherry puncheon, delivering warming spice, dried stone fruit, and the rich, complex sweetness characteristic of Highlands whisky finished in the finest Spanish casks. Bottled in November 2014 with 708 bottles produced.
